How should I choose a weight loss supplement that is safe and effective?

Given the numerous choices on the market, selecting a weight loss supplement that is both safe and effective can be difficult. You can, however, arrive at a well-informed decision that places your health and wellbeing first by adhering to a few important guidelines.

Before beginning any weight loss supplement, it is essential to consult a healthcare professional. They are able to look at your past medical history, current health, and any potential interactions you may have with any medications. This is a crucial step to take to make sure the supplement you choose is safe for your body and won’t cause any problems. Always choose supplements for weight loss that have gone through extensive clinical trials and scientific research. Look for supplements that have been tested on a large number of people and have always been good. Also, think about products that have been checked out and approved by reputable regulatory bodies like the FDA in the United States or something like that in your country.

It is essential to read and comprehend the product’s label and packaging thoroughly. Examine the supplement’s ingredients, dosage instructions, and potential side effects for clear and comprehensive information. Products that use proprietary blends or conceal specific ingredient amounts should be avoided. Instead, look for supplements that specify the amounts of each ingredient in detail.

The manufacturer’s credibility and reputation are another consideration. Find out more about the supplement’s manufacturer to make sure they have a track record of producing high-quality goods and place a high value on consumer safety. Look for manufacturers with certifications from independent third-party testing organizations and adhering to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P).

Reviews and feedback from customers can be very helpful in determining the supplement’s safety and effectiveness. Check out reputable forums or online platforms where people talk about their experiences with various weight loss supplements. Be wary of overly enthusiastic reviews and exaggerated claims because they may be sponsored or biased.

Supplements that promise quick or unrealistic weight loss results should be avoided. A healthy diet, regular exercise, and healthy lifestyle choices are all necessary for sustaining weight loss, which is a gradual process. Supplements that make exaggerated claims without any scientific evidence should be avoided.
